In love there are no good-bys.

I take your hand now, but not to say good-by; I feel that you are still mine--that you will be mine more than ever when you think--think--and pray." "Ah! You ask me to pray ?" "Pray--pray for me, child.

I need the prayers of such as you, for I feel that my hour of deepest trial is drawing nigh.

Do you fancy that I am the man to take back anything that I have written?
Look at me, Phyllis; I tell you here that I will stand by everything that I have written.
Whatever comes of it, the book remains.

Even if I lose all that I have worked for,--even if I lose you,--I will still say 'the book remains.' I am ready to suffer for it.
